Physical units
For trouble-free operation, the units of the process data transmitted on the field bus have to be defined.
They can be set in the menu
Physical units Profibus
called by
Parameters/Fieldbus/Profibus
.
The
parameters of the physical units should be set once and then remain unchanged during a
running application.
Unit-related factors are calculated internally so that all the user has to do is to select the desired unit.
The gear ratio and the feed constant are stated as separate parameters.

When the physical units are entered, the firmware automatically calculates conversion factors. They
consist of a numerator and a denominator which can comprise a maximum of 32 bits each. If an
overflow occurs when the factors are entered, the value will be rejected. In this case, the factors or the
physical units have to be corrected.
It has to be taken into consideration that some quantities cannot always be used in a sensible manner.
A purely rotative system, for example, does not require a feed constant. Apart from this, the feed
constant has a physical unit. If this unit is not parameterized correctly, the feed constant will be
ignored.
